Almost half of Victoria Point’s stylish apartments snapped up by young buyers

Over 40% of the 216 luxury apartments at a prestigious new development in Ashford, Kent, have been snapped up by eager buyers with completion not due until autumn 2020.

Phase 1 of Victoria Point, the £55 million development by Elevate Property Group, is already sold out and property agents Savills report that Phase 2 is selling fast.

New photos released of the newly-opened show apartment reveal the features and luxury specification that is attracting young buyers in the area.

Victoria Point offers a range of studios, one, two and three-bedroom apartments, with prices currently ranging from £142,500 to £355,000.

The majority of apartments have balconies or terraces, some with views over the landscaped gardens towards the Great Stour and Victoria Park.

Tom Bryant, head of residential development sales for Savills in the South East, comments: “As we move closer to the completion this autumn, we are beginning to see more owner occupiers, in particular young professionals, seeing the benefits of living at Victoria Point.”

“This has been helped by the launch of two new show apartments, showcasing the high-quality specification and generous size of the apartments. In addition, Victoria Point’s exemplary amenities, with the Super Lounge, concierge service and large courtyard garden, have resulted in increased demand from this particular demographic.”

He says that along with the development’s close proximity to the town centre and Ashford International railway station, a key driver for enquiries at Victoria Point has been the high speed rail link to London, making Ashford better connected than many areas of central London and at more affordable prices.

Ashford International is just 200 metres from Victoria Point, offering journeys as short as 36 minutes from London St Pancras by train, and is less than two hours from Brussels and Paris by Eurostar.

David Hofton, sales and marketing director of Elevate Property Group, adds: “Ashford’s excellent transport links, plus the ongoing regeneration of the area, make it a very attractive town to live in.”

“During 2019, we saw the Ashford Designer Outlet expansion completed and the opening of Junction 10A on the M20, with continuing developments at Ashford College, Elwick Place and Connect 38 in the Ashford Commercial Quarter.”

Hofton says with fast transport connections, millions of pounds of inward investment, growing leisure and shopping opportunities and a vibrant culture, Ashford has ‘a really excellent future’ ahead of it.

He concludes: “Victoria Point, with Help to Buy available, is a real opportunity for young couples to get a start on the housing ladder – and what a way to start!”
